CLAY

Soda Fired Pots

My stoneware and porcelain clay pots are wheel thrown and hand altered.... clay slips, glazes and oxide washes are used to decorate them.... they are then fired to 2350 F in an atmospheric firing where soda and wood are introduced to offer unique flashings and finishes.... these pots are designed and made to be used daily

 

FIBERS

Blankets / Ponchos / Shawls / Table Runners

The handwoven pieces are made on a four harness loom.... most of the yarns are handspun, hand-dyed, or hand painted.... they vary in texture, size and color.... making a piece from natural fibers such as mohair, wool, buffalo and alpaca offers a unique and colorful blanket of cloth that offers warmth and an intriguing palette of colour..... because of the many varying fibers I recommend drycleaning
